The Padmapurana is a one of the largest of the eighteen Major Puranas containing roughly 50,000 metrical verses. Although popular for its inclusion of the Ramayana and large sections on pilgrimage guides this is also known for its dedication to both Shiva and Vishnu. This is verse 122 contained in chapter 3 of book 1 (सृष्टिखण्ड, sṛṣṭikhaṇḍa).
Verse 1.3.122
ऋषीणां नामधेयानि यथा वेदे श्रुतानि वै ।
यथानियोगं योग्यानि अन्येषामपि सोकरोत् ॥ १२२ ॥
ṛṣīṇāṃ nāmadheyāni yathā vede śrutāni vai |
yathāniyogaṃ yogyāni anyeṣāmapi sokarot || 122 ||
